  • Patent number: 7862850
    Abstract: A panel (9) is conveyed by using a conveyer (3), and the coating surface of the panel (9) is divided into two coating areas (CAa, CAb). Further, the coating areas (CAa, CAb) are coated by reciprocating sprayer units (6, 7) parallel to a conveying direction. At this time, at a boundary between the coating areas (CAa, CAb), the positions of turning paths (Ta0, Tb0) of the reciprocation of a coating machine are shifted sequentially from the front side to the rear side in the conveying direction, so that coating trajectories (Ta, Tb) like a series of steps are formed. Thus, at the boundary between the coating areas (CAa, CAb), the turning paths (Ta0, Tb0) can be spread and located, and the occurrence of color shading can be prevented.

  • Patent number: 7691450
    Abstract: Two sprayer units are arranged along a conveyer. A coating surface of a panel conveyed by the conveyer is divided into four coating areas. Then, the sprayer units reciprocate parallel to the conveying direction and coat the individual coating areas. At this time, at the boundaries of the coating areas, the positions of the turning paths for reciprocation of the sprayer units are shifted from the front side to the rear side in the conveying direction and step-like coating trajectories are formed. As a result, the size of the area coated by each of the sprayer units can be expanded.
